The .NET Framework is a software framework developed by Microsoft that runs primarily on Microsoft Windows. It includes a large class library called Framework Class Library and provides language interoperability across several programming languages.

Boxcast is a live video streaming platform that allows users to easily broadcast events and presentations to an online audience in real time. It integrates with common hardware like cameras and microphones to stream HD quality video.
